Output f75965dd86a6aeb33167afbb1d33ffd2b941d8a03a19d549daf263cbb2e2bae7:0

value
10042940
script pubkey
OP_0 OP_PUSHBYTES_20 7f78523a8665fc8feeed630446691cc3c1d03c60
address
bc1q0au9yw5xvh7glmhdvvzyv6guc0qaq0rqlwgsy6
transaction
f75965dd86a6aeb33167afbb1d33ffd2b941d8a03a19d549daf263cbb2e2bae7
confirmations
57953
spent
true